How to turn on Voice Chat in Overwatch 2?

Here are the required steps to turn on the Voice Chat in the game –

1) First and foremost, you have to launch the game and go to the game’s home screen.

2) Next, go to the game’s Main Menu screen to find Options. You can do this by pressing the ESC key on the home screen.

3) Then, you have to go to the game’s Options to find the different settings available in the game. After doing so, you have to go to the Sound tab.

4) After going to the Sound options, you have to go to Voice Chat. You can make adjustments to the volume level of different sounds in the game. Likewise, turn on the Match Voice Chat option.

5) Now, you have to go down to Capture and find the Voice Chat Mode option. Likewise, you have to click or select the Voice Chat Mode option. After doing so, you can then see a list of the different chat modes available. You have to select the Open Mic option.

6) Finally, you can now turn on and use the voice chat feature in the game.
